My Mom asked today when he naps. It's hard to say because each day is different. Hopefully someday we will have a schedule. He takes somewhere between 2 and 3 naps a day and they last anywhere from 45 minutes to 2 and 1/2 hours.

When we got the update about Elias pre-travel we found out he ate 2-3 oz. every 2 hours. He now eats 6 oz. every 3-4 hours. It was a really easy transition. We started right away with 4 ozs. and knew after a couple days that wasn't enough because he was angry each time he finished. He always lets us know when he has had enough which is really nice too. We go to the doctor tomorrow and I will talk to him about getting this chunky monkey on some solids. His night time routine is a lot more structured than naps. He falls asleep between 6:15 and 6:30pm. He always wakes at 2:30am for a bottle and diaper change. Yes...that is a full 8 hours!!!! Since we have been home he has been waking up at 11:30pm for a bottle but in Ethiopia he would go straight from 6:30-2:30. He is up again at 5:30am and is awake for good. It's early but when he goes to sleep later he still wakes at 5:30 on the dot. I really have no complaints when I have a baby who is in bed more or less for 11 hours each night!
